Thymosin
A hormone produced by the thymus gland that plays a role in the maturation of T cells involved in the immune response.
Immune System
The body's defense mechanism against pathogens, including both innate and adaptive immune responses.
Enkephalins
Are pentapeptides involved in regulating nociception in the body; they function as neurotransmitters or neuromodulators.
Dynorphins
A class of opioid peptides produced in many parts of the brain, known for their role in modulating pain, emotion, stress, and addiction.
